How to bid on a Pickup Truck Mounted Message Board for Ohio DOT
What the Ohio DOT is buying
The Ohio Department of Transportation (ODOT) is seeking to purchase one pickup truck mounted message board. This equipment is categorized under traffic control. How to respond
The solicitation, SRC0000041799, is posted on OhioBuys, Ohio's eProcurement portal. You can view the full solicitation details and documents publicly in your web browser without an account. To download documents or to submit your response, you will need to sign in with a free OHID supplier account. Ensure you have your OHID supplier account set up well before the deadline.
